The Westones are a powerhouse supergroup from Oakland, fusing heavy soul, deep-pocket funk, and raw R&B into a sound that’s as timeless as it is fresh. Featuring seasoned players who have toured nationally with acts like Dirtwire, Con Brio, Midtown Social, Smoked Out Soul, Afrolicious and The Routine, the band brings a rare mix of chops, chemistry, and grit.

Big Blu Soul Quarter bring the soul of San Francisco to their music and live show. The band shares an extreme passion for the music of 60’s and 70’s soul, funk and jazz… the classic sounds of Motown, Stax, Daptones and Blue Note Records but with a fresh and original spin.
Black Joe Lewis is a blues, funk and soul artist influenced by Howlin' Wolf and James Brown. He formed Black Joe Lewis & The Honeybears in Austin, Texas, in 2007. In March 2009, Esquire listed Black Joe Lewis and the Honeybears as one of the "Ten Bands Set to Break Out at 2009's SXSW Festival."
